In this episode, I am joined by Karla Garcia as she shares her journey from humble beginnings to establishing her own practice, Leonia Speech and Language Services, LLC.
Karla discusses her dual experiences with privilege and minority challenges, how she overcame bullying and stuttering, and her advocacy for bilingual and minority families. She highlights the significance of support systems, her specialized approach to Gestalt Language Processing, and offers advice to minorities entering the field.
Karla also explains how she balances a full-time job with a growing private practice, and the importance of acceptance and diversity in speech therapy.
